A+Technical Description
The Balkancar Record ER 634.33.242 S is an electric forklift designed for medium-duty lifting and material handling tasks. It operates on a battery-powered 10.1 hp (7 kW) electric motor, allowing for efficient and emission-free operation. The forklift has a maximum load capacity of 3,527.4 lbs with a load center of 19.7 inches, making it suitable for a variety of warehouse and industrial applications. Its mast offers a maximum fork height of 10.9 feet and features lift and lower speeds of 55.2 ft/min and 59.1 ft/min respectively, enabling smooth and precise load handling. The mast also has a slight forward tilt of 4 degrees and a rear tilt of 8 degrees to enhance load stability during transport. Dimensionally, the unit measures 6.4 feet in length to the fork face, with an overall height of 7.3 feet when the mast is lowered and 6.8 feet to the top of the overhead guard. It has a ground clearance of 3.2 inches, an overall width of 3.3 feet, a wheelbase of 4.2 feet, and a turning radius of 5.8 feet, offering good maneuverability in tight indoor spaces. The forklift’s pneumatic tires, configured with two front and two rear wheels, provide traction and stability across various surfaces. Weighing 6,530 lbs, this forklift balances robustness with operational agility. It reaches a maximum travel speed of 8.1 mph (13 kph), facilitating quick and efficient movement within facilities. Overall, the Balkancar Record ER 634.33.242 S is a compact, battery-powered forklift that combines reliable power, moderate lifting capacity, and maneuverability for indoor logistics and material handling operations.
